Fernando Legguard He didn’t hide. He could do it. He was able to walk past the mixed zone, take refuge in the locker room, remain silent on a night that had marked him out in front of an entire country. But the goalkeeper Uruguay chose to show his face after a very tough elimination for Celeste in the World Cup 2026consummated after the defeat by 1-0 in view of Spain and marked by his error in the goal of Alex Baena.

It was a heavy image. An apparently controllable shot, a ball that chipped before reaching his hands and an action that ended inside the Uruguayan goal. Spain He found there the goal he needed to close the game and Uruguayforced to win to stay alive, was left out in the group stage. The blow was sporting, emotional and personal. Especially for Legguardwho did not come out to play the second half.

Bielsa: “I leave nothing to Uruguay”

Marcelo Bielsa He confirmed it later at a press conference. The Uruguayan coach explained that the change at half-time was not a technical decision imposed from the bench, but rather a request from the goalkeeper himself. “He decided to leave,” the coach said. When cross-examined, Bielsa was blunt: “I already answered that.” Later he expanded it with another equally direct phrase: “Legguard “He asked to go out.”

The night left Bielsa pointed out, to Uruguay already sunk Legguard broken. The goalkeeper, however, was the only player who stopped before the media to explain how he felt after a World which he himself assumed was disappointing. “I was never one to hide, I was always one to show my face,” he started. It was his way of speaking to a fans hit by a elimination unexpected and for a performance that left many open wounds.

Legguard He didn’t look for excuses. He also did not protect himself behind the bus. “This is also the closest way I have to speak to all the Uruguayans“, he explained. And there he left one of the hardest phrases of the night: “I never imagined I would be suffering so much from this sportespecially with all the work I did, because of how I prepared myself.”

The goalkeeper admitted that the blow hurt him especially because of everything he had invested to reach the tournament in good condition. His return to the national team, his presence as a starter and the trust placed by Bielsa They had been a strong bet. But he World It ended in the worst way for him and for Uruguay. “Today, with the preparation I had, I have not had a good World Cup,” he acknowledged.

Before speaking to the press, Legguard had already given explanations within the locker room. He told it himself, still in pain: “As I told the boys in the locker room, when the game was over and they were all a little calmer…”. There he asked for forgiveness from his companions. Then he did it publicly. “I apologized to them and I apologize to the entire town. Uruguayanalthough that is not enough.”

That was the tone of his entire intervention: absolute responsibility, self-criticism and a sadness that was difficult to hide. Legguard assumed the weight of a night that will remain associated with his mistakebut also to his decision not to disappear. In a soccer in which explanations are often avoided, the goalkeeper appeared to put words to his fall.

Bielsafor its part, also assumed its share of failure. “Responsibility of my management,” stated the coach, who acknowledged that Uruguay He had “a potential” that he was not able to transform into a team in line with expectations. “I couldn’t go beyond the work, the effort, the dedication,” he added. For the coach, the Celeste deserved more during the group stage, but the results were relentless: “We played to have seven points and we add two”.

The coach defended the call and ownership of Legguard despite the outcome. “Summoning Muslera was a very thoughtful decision,” he explained. Bielsa He recalled that the goalkeeper was coming off “a very good year” and highlighted his personality. “The decision was to maintain confidence in Muslera and not take it away,” he said. A trust that ended up becoming one of the great debates of the Uruguayan elimination.

The defeat against Spain not only closed the World of Uruguay. It also opened a period of reproaches, balances and uncomfortable questions. Bielsa He was hard on himself: “My step will be remembered as a step that left nothing.” A devastating phrase for a project that had generated hope and ended up collapsing at the decisive moment.

Legguardon the other hand, tried to look just a little beyond the blow. “Now it’s time to be with those closest to us, gather energy and move forward,” he said. It didn’t sound like consolation, but rather survival. Because, as the goalkeeper himself explained, his position It has that rawness: “This sport and this position they have that, sometimes they give you a lot and sometimes they take away from you.”

This time it took too much away from him. took away Uruguay he World. took away Bielsa margin. Already Legguard left him a night of pain, a mistake impossible to erase and an appearance that had a lot of sincerity: that of a goalkeeper who failed, asked to leave and then asked for forgiveness.
